It is important to be aware of potential signs of brain injury following a traumatic event. Not all symptoms may appear immediately, so observing changes over time is key. Some common signs to look out for include:
- Headache or head pain that does not subside
- Repeated vomiting or nausea
- Confusion or difficulty concentrating
- Memory loss or inability to recall details of the accident
- Dizziness or loss of balance when standing or walking
- Ringing in the ears (tinnitus) or changes to vision or hearing
- Sensitivity to light or noise
- Sleep disturbances, fatigue, or lethargy
- Mood changes such as irritability, anxiety, or depression
- Slowed thinking, lower reaction times, or impaired judgment
- Slurred or difficult speech
- Seizures or loss of consciousness after the event

What Brain Injuries Can You Recover Compensation for?
If you sustained a brain injury due to someone else’s negligence, such as a car accident, you may be entitled to financial compensation. Some of the most common traumatic brain injuries that qualify for recovery include:
- Concussions: A mild form of brain injury that disrupts typical brain function. Effects can persist long-term.
- Contusions: Bruising of the brain tissue caused by blows to the head. Symptoms range from moderate to severe.
- Hematomas: Bleeding on the brain surface or between layers of tissue, usually requiring medical intervention.
- Skull fractures: Cracks or breaks in the bones protecting the brain, which can directly impact brain function.
- Abrasions: Scrapes to surface blood vessels, causing intracranial swelling and pressure bleeding under the skull.
- Diffuse axonal injury: Shearing forces within the brain disrupt neural connections controlling coordination and cognition.
- Penetration injuries: Objects piercing brain tissue result in localized damage in addition to swelling effects.

There are several types of damages a brain injury lawyer may be able to recover on your behalf through litigation or settlement. A brain damage lawyer in Mt. Vernon can help you recover losses such as:
- Medical expenses: This includes all past and future costs for doctor visits, hospital stays, rehabilitation, prescription medications, home health care, and assisted living.
- Lost wages: If the brain injury prevented you from working or led to reduced earning capacity in the long term, lost income can be recovered.
- Pain and suffering: Compensation for physical and emotional pain, as well as long-term lifestyle and independence limitations.
- Disability or impairments: Damages for permanent cognitive, physical, or neurological deficits limiting activities of daily living.
- Loss of enjoyment of life: Funds to offset reduced quality of life due to impairment of normal activities from the injury.
- Caregiver expenses: Costs borne by relatives for providing the assistance you now require.
- Vocational rehabilitation: Costs associated with retraining for a new career due to permanent limitations.
- Punitive damages: In cases of severe negligence, additional damages may be awarded for wrongful actions.
By working with a lawyer, the full scope of financial responsibilities arising from your brain injury can be addressed through a damages award or settlement to aid your long-term recovery and care.
